The National Zoological Park (NZP) in Delhi is facing allegations from its workers' union regarding the death of a jackal. The union claims the animal suffocated inside a bear den after staff used chili powder and fire to force it out. The incident has sparked calls for an independent inquiry and raised concerns about animal welfare protocols at the zoo.
